WebSmall pebbles are placed around the stepping stones to complete the path and give it a look that resembles a boardwalk. 2.The Pebbled Path This path is designed to resemble a … WebJun 3, 2024 · Next, lay the stones of your path. Set them about six to eight inches apart and keep them level. Press them into the topsoil to lock them in place, being sure to keep the majority of the stone well above the surface of the soil. Use a level to check the surface of each stone before placing the next one and make adjustments as necessary. (Image credit: Future/Ruth Hayes) Place the stones in their newly … terracotta pot sealer bunningsWebDec 10, 2024 · Place the stepping stone slab into the hole and use a spirit level to make sure it’s level, either with the ground or just below the surface. If it’s not, use a rubber mallet to tap it into position. Never use a standard hammer on paving slabs or stepping stones as you could crack or break them. Place the stepping stones in their respective places and walk along your path a few times. Take time to stand on each stone for a few seconds to tamp them down further and help them settle into the ground.
